導航:首頁 > 軟體知識 > 程序描述哪個正確的

程序描述哪個正確的

發布時間:2022-01-23 19:00:33

1. 下面是關於解釋程序和編譯程序的敘述,正確的是()

C、D

解釋程序是一種語言處理程序,在詞法、語法和語義分析方面與編譯程序的工作原理基本相同,但在運行用戶程序時,它直接執行源程序或源程序的內部形式(中間代碼)。因此,解釋程序並不產生目標程序,這是它和編譯程序的主要區別。

解釋程序它逐條地取出源程序中的語句,邊解釋,邊執行。編譯的話就是只要編譯一次,下次再執行就不用再解釋了。

(1)程序描述哪個正確的擴展閱讀:

解釋程序的工作方式非常適於人通過終端設備與計算機會話,如在終端上打一條命令或語句,解釋程序就立即將此語句解釋成一條或幾條指令並提交硬體立即執行且將執行結果反映到終端,從終端把命令打入後,就能立即得到計算結果。

這的確是很方便的,很適合於一些小型機的計算問題。但解釋程序執行速度很慢,例如源程序中出現循環,則解釋程序也重復地解釋並提交執行這一組語句,這就造成很大浪費。

對源程序邊解釋翻譯成機器代碼邊執行的高級語言程序。所以,解釋程序的功能是:解釋執行高級語言程序。由於它的方便性和交互性較好,早期一些高級語言採用這種方式,如BASIC、dBASE。但它的弱點是運行效率低,程序的運行依賴於開發環境,不能直接在操作系統下運行。

網路-解釋程序

2. 對下列程序的描述正確的是( )。 #include <stdio.h> int main()

通過實際驗證了的結果,答案是A這里我分布說明,程序的過程: 第一步計算:x=y=1; 第二步計算:z=x; 結果z=1; 第三步計算:x++; 結果x=2; 第四步計算:y++; 前面賦值y=1;y++後y=2; 第五步計算:++y; 前面y++後,y=2這里++y; 結果y=3; 最後結果:x=2;y=3;z=1 只要明白了,運算的優先權,就能很好的理解並計算

3. 有程序如下,關於程序的描述哪個是正確的

首先,程序沒有語法錯誤。其實,看執行,if的條件很關鍵。這里是x=y-4,注意這是一條賦值語句而不是條件語句。賦值的結果是x=4.出於編譯系統自動進行類型轉換的功能,放在if中,他會轉換為一個布爾值真。所以,執行 printf(「*」);的語句,也就是輸出*。結果就是B。

4. 編譯並運行以下程序,以下描述哪個選項是正確的

第2行確實會出錯,原因有兩個:
1:protectied 不是關鍵字,正確的應該是protected

2:toString( )i ,方法的括弧後面不能出現無意義的字元串

5. 讀程序,以下描述中正確的是哪一個

你的原題是這個吧:
下列敘述中正確的是()。
A.每個c程序文件中都必須要有一個main函數
B.在C程序中main()的位置是固定的
C.C程序中所有函數之間都可以相互調用,與函數所在位置無關
D.在C程序的函數中不能定義另一個函數

關於D,這里有一段解釋:
C語言規定,函數的定義不能嵌套,即不能在函數的定義體內又包含另一個函數的定義。這就保證了每一個函數是一個獨立的和功能單一的程序單元。在由多個函數組成的c語言程序中,函數定義的先後順序與其被調用的先後次序無關,即函數的定義次序不影響其調用次序。由此可以看出,一個c語言的程序實質上是一系列相互獨立的函數的定義,函數之間只存在調用和被調用的關系。

最重要的是第一句:函數的定義不能嵌套。
我覺得你是不是把定義理解為強調了,如果子函數在main函數下方,在調用函數前是要先強調一下的,但那不是定義。

至於A,注意題目說的是文件,調用文件(如頭文件)就不需要main函數,它也是一個文件啊。
B顯然是不對的,這就不用解釋了吧。
C錯在,函數要先定義了才能調用,函數位置在前就先定義,前面的不能調用後面的。

我也剛學C語言1個學期,說的可能有一些偏差,但希望能幫到你,祝你進步!

6. C語言 對下面的程序描述正確的是()

B、y-4=1賦值給x,If里為真,輸出*

7. 10、關於如下程序結構的描述中,哪一項是正確的( ) for( ; ; ) { 循環體; }

明顯死循環
判斷語句為空 執行的結果永遠是真

8. 有以下程序,以下敘述中正確的是_____。

答案為C 。 while最後有一個分號。表示這個循環只有在不滿足條件的情況下才會跳出。而當按回車鍵。相當於輸入了'\n',即不滿足getchar()!='\0',所以才能跳出循環繼續向下執行~

9. 4、單選 下面描述中,正確的是( )。 (5分) A 一個正確的程序就是指程序書寫正確。 B

題目需要補充完整。目前的A選項是錯誤的。
「加油,你可以的,頭已經出來了……」

閱讀全文

與程序描述哪個正確的相關的資料

熱點內容
如何設置外服代理游戲 瀏覽:617
保羅數據不如威少是什麼原因 瀏覽:521
疫苗預約健康通如何解綁寶寶信息 瀏覽:90
代理服裝需要什麼資質 瀏覽:895
中成葯全國代理如何做 瀏覽:781
廣州第二職業技術學院怎麼樣 瀏覽:369
如何清除非必要的系統程序 瀏覽:233
程序員穿什麼顏色的鞋子 瀏覽:466
幣圈什麼是場內交易和場外交易 瀏覽:596
化工交易市場在哪裡 瀏覽:861
手機插數據線反應慢是什麼原因 瀏覽:1
如何拍攝產品照片 瀏覽:473
京東農產品怎麼報名 瀏覽:297
物聯網應用技術可以去什麼公司 瀏覽:599
杭州微盟代理商怎麼申請 瀏覽:20
蘭州常見鹼類化工產品有哪些 瀏覽:988
學生人臉識別程序怎麼用 瀏覽:296
159素食全餐佐丹力如何代理 瀏覽:827
小程序如何設置文章列表 瀏覽:477
微信景區預約小程序是什麼來的 瀏覽:65